Re: HELP PLEASE (coilovers)

Lowering springs and coilover sleeves can have a great ride and handling if you use quality products and good struts.

Lowering springs are shorter/stiffer springs
Sleeves are shorter/stiffer springs with an adjustable collar that fits between the spring & spring perch on the strut.

It all depends what your going to use the car for. Any type of adjustable height is a pain for street use if you plan on actually using the adjustments. After each change in ride height you have to get an alignment and corner weighting is rec. Do you really need that for the street? No.
